**Source Insight是一款强大的源代码查看和编辑工具,尤其在编程领域中被广泛使用。它提供了对多种编程语言的支持,包括C、C++、Java、Python等,并具备代码高亮、语法自动完成、智能跳转等功能,极大地提高了程序员的开发效率。下面将详细介绍Source Insight的使用方法和一些实用技巧。** ### 1. 安装与启动 你需要下载Source Insight安装包,按照提示进行安装。安装完成后,双击图标启动程序。首次打开时,可能需要设置工作目录,这通常是你的项目或代码存储的位置。 ### 2. 项目管理 在Source Insight中,项目是代码文件的集合。你可以通过"File"菜单的"New Project"创建新项目,或者"Open Project"打开已有的项目。在项目中,可以添加、删除或组织文件,方便代码管理。 ### 3. 代码浏览 Source Insight可以快速浏览代码文件。使用"File"菜单的"Open File"或直接在项目窗口双击文件名,即可打开代码。代码会以高亮显示,便于区分关键字、变量和注释。 ### 4. 代码跳转 Source Insight的强大之处在于其代码导航功能。你可以通过单击函数或变量名,使用"Go To Definition"(F12)跳转到定义处。此外,"Find References"(Ctrl+Shift+F7)可以查找所有引用该符号的地方。 ### 5. 搜索与替换 使用"Search"菜单,你可以进行文本搜索或正则表达式搜索。"Find/Replace"功能支持在当前文件、整个项目或自定义范围内进行查找和替换。 ### 6. 书签与注解 Source Insight允许你在代码中设置书签,便于快速定位。"Bookmark"菜单可进行书签的添加、删除和跳转。同时,你还可以添加临时或永久的注解,为代码添加个人笔记。 ### 7. 自动完成与智能提示 在编写代码时,Source Insight会提供自动完成功能。只需输入部分函数名或变量名,按下空格或Tab键,即可得到补全建议。此外,"Code Hints"功能会在输入过程中显示相关函数的参数信息。 ### 8. 符号索引 Source Insight构建了一个符号索引,可以通过"Symbol Browser"(Ctrl+Shift+B)快速查找项目中的函数、变量和类型。这在处理大型代码库时特别有用。 ### 9. 设置与个性化 Source Insight的设置选项丰富,你可以调整字体大小、颜色主题、快捷键布局等,以适应个人习惯。"Preferences"菜单提供了这些定制选项。 ### 10. 快捷键与工作效率 熟悉Source Insight的快捷键能大大提高工作效率。例如,F3用于查找下一个匹配项,Ctrl+G用于快速跳转到指定行,Ctrl+D用于复制当前行。 ### 实用技巧 - 使用"History"(F7)查看最近访问过的文件。 - "Project"菜单下的"Rebuild Symbol Info"更新项目符号信息,确保新添加的代码能正确索引。 - "Outline"视图可以展示当前文件的结构,方便理解和导航。 通过以上介绍,你应该对Source Insight的使用有了基本了解。实际操作中,不断探索和实践将使你更加熟练掌握这个强大的工具。希望这份指南能帮助你在编程旅程中走得更远。
- 1
- 粉丝: 0
- 资源: 6
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助